Israeli raids injure three and lead to mass arrests in occupied West Bank
The number of Palestinians wounded by Israeli gunfire during the ongoing raid on Qalandiya camp in the occupied West Bank has risen to three, Al Jazeera Arabic reported.
In the Fawwar refugee camp, south of Hebron, Israeli forces have launched a “large-scale arrest campaign,” conducting field interrogations in the camp’s main square. According to Shehab news agency, dozens of detainees were allegedly subjected to abuse during the raid.
Meanwhile, Wafa news agency reported that Israeli forces arrested at least 25 Palestinians from the town of Tuqu, east of Bethlehem, as part of the escalating crackdown across the occupied West Bank.
